The Danish Agriculture and Food Council has just relaunched its website, and now provides both industry news updates and topical content relating to the Danish pig industry.  

The website – www.agricultureandfood.co.uk – has a business to business focus and includes pages for statistics, market research and quality assurance information.

Visitors to the new site can also use it as a Danish pig industry news channel, which will provide the latest relevant data and stories in subjects like animal welfare, food safety, risk management on a farm and the environment. The site will also be a platform for topical, opinion-based content, written in blog form.

The website will still maintain its traditional role as a ‘go to’ source for authoritative information and background on the Danish pig industry.

In addition, the site includes a media centre, where users will find an archive of press releases, key facts and figures, and a series of useful links.

Robert Smith, the UK market director for the Danish Agriculture and Food Council, said: “Our aim for the website is to ensure that it is interesting, relevant and thought-provoking.
